在线客服
扫描二维码
下载博学谷APP扫描二维码
关注博学谷微信公众号
普通人学Python有用吗?学Python有没有用因人而异,有些人纯粹是兴趣爱好想了解一下,另一些在工作中涉及到数据分析统计,学会Python可以大大提高工作效率,剩下的就是程序员了,靠技术吃饭的人,多掌握一门编程语言对于日后的升值加薪有大的增益。
都说学一门编程语言对工作学习帮助都很大,但是非IT行业人员有必要学习Python吗?这门语言在人工智能领域比较火,有些人也是前沿技术比较感兴趣,但是就是不知道学习了Python可以做什么?有什么帮助?有些人学习使用的话可以开发哪些软件或者学这个转行IT领域怎么样?有没有这个必要?基于对人工智能、编程感兴趣,所以提出了一系列的问题。
Python是一种很高效的工具,通过它能自己编程,完成数据收集,还可以批量化自动操作简单任务,代替枯燥的手工操作,另外还能通过学习它,了解计算机的编程思维。
非码农有没有必要学习一门编程语言?如果前者的答案是有必要那么是否要选Python?对于第一个问题,有人认为有一定必要,非码农学习一门编程语言的投产比不算太低。盘点一下收益的话,最起码可以对自己思维的重新梳理,编程对逻辑思维和抽象思维的要求比较高,想学好编程需要一定程度上让自己具备这两种思维习惯,当然学习数学也可以锻炼,但是私以为数学更难掌握一门手艺。
技不压身一定程度上提升现有工作的效率,有不少行业里面有些地方是可以靠写代码自动化解决一些小问题的,收益还不错,比如一些枯燥的重复的Excel表格处理,如果选择学习一门编程语言,Python即使不是最优选择也是Top3之内了。无论语言的入门难度、应用场景还是未来发展,Python都还算不错。
如果不选Python,还有一个选择就是Javascript+nodejs了。非科班出身学习一门编程语言,不要有太高的直接变现的预期,因为以互联网为代表的IT行业从业人员已经趋于饱和,当然高端市场还是紧缺的,如果有信心自学进入高端市场也可以,只是难度很大。至于人工智能,这个还是科学前沿,真想学的话建议先把编程入门再考虑。
其实Python已经融入到我们的生活和学习中来了,Python将纳入浙江省高考!从 2018 年起浙江省信息技术教材编程语言将会更换为 Python;Python纳入山东省的小学教材课程,小学生都开始接触 Python 语言了;Python 将加入全国计算机等级考试!教育部考试中心决定自2018年起,在计算机二级考试加入了“Python语言程序设计”科目。现在国外国内很多家长已经给孩子报名学习Python编程课程了。在美国,就连婴幼儿也有专门的编程童书。
学习Python的优势在于其功能库众多,特别适合快速开发或者作为胶水性语言工具。网站后端程序员、自动化运维、数据挖掘及分析、游戏开发(作为脚本)、自动化测试、网站开发(借助django,flask框架自己搭建网站)、爬虫、机器学习、量化交易。Python简单高效,Python关键字少,结构简单,语法清晰,非常适合小白入门编程。
— 申请免费试学名额 —
在职想转行提升,担心学不会?根据个人情况规划学习路线,闯关式自适应学习模式保证学习效果
讲师一对一辅导,在线答疑解惑,指导就业!
相关推荐 更多
为什么Python编程语言应用如此广泛?
很多人都知道Python是一门简单易学、应用广泛的编程语言。但是大家是否真的明白为什么它能够简单易学?为什么能够应用广泛吗?同为编程语言,为什么Python更适合实现自动化运维?为什么Python能够实现科学计算?为什么Python是人工智能的首选语言?带着这些疑问,小编为大家揭秘Python为什么应用如此广泛?
6460
2019-11-12 17:27:00
学Python前需要学什么才能打好基础?
学Python前需要学什么才能打好基础?如果是有一定计算机编程基础相对学习Python更容易些,零基础小白也不用担心,Python是一门简洁、优雅、易读的编程语言,相对其他的学科容易很多。
7681
2020-03-06 11:48:49
Python运算符总结
所有的编程语言本质就是在解决运算逻辑,通过各种算法实现想要的各种功能,因此在学习Python编程语言时,不仅要掌握各种变量类型,深刻理解函数式编程的原理,还要彻底搞懂各类运算符的使用。通过本片文章你可以了解到在Python编程开发中的各类运算符以及其使用方法。
5515
2020-06-08 16:31:37
装饰器是什么?为什么要学习装饰器?
装饰器用于拓展原来函数功能的一种函数,在不改变原函数名或类名的情况下给函数增加新的功能。给已有函数增加额外功能的函数,它本质上就是一个闭包函数,我们学习得主要目的是掌握装饰器的语法格式。
3275
2021-12-06 11:11:22
闭包是什么?具体怎么使用?
闭包是什么?具体怎么使用?闭包是使用外部函数变量的内部函数,闭包可以保存外部函数内的变量,不会随着外部函数调用完而销毁。
3361
2022-02-11 15:42:50